Choosing the Right Type
I learned that there are different types of power supplies available. I had to decide between modular, semi-modular, and non-modular options. Modular power supplies allow me to connect only the cables I need, reducing clutter and improving airflow in my case. Semi-modular options provide a mix of fixed and detachable cables, while non-modular power supplies come with all cables permanently attached.
Efficiency Ratings Matter
I quickly discovered the importance of efficiency ratings. I looked for a power supply with at least an 80 PLUS certification. This certification indicates that the power supply operates efficiently, wasting less energy and reducing my electricity bill. Higher ratings, like 80 PLUS Gold or Platinum, offer even better performance and energy savings.
Checking for Compatibility
Compatibility was another crucial factor in my decision-making process. I ensured that the power supply would fit in my case and that it had the right connectors for my motherboard, GPU, and other components. I made a checklist of all the connectors I needed, such as ATX, EPS, PCIe, and SATA.

Wattage Headroom
I realized the importance of having some headroom in wattage capacity. A 1500 watt power supply gives me the flexibility to upgrade my components in the future without worrying about exceeding the power supply’s limits. I aimed for at least 20-30% headroom above my current needs.
